SiO2 and Rb-Sr ratios vs crustal thickness in central and south western America (NERC grant NE/K008862/1)

A GEOROC (http://georoc.mpch-mainz.gwdg.de/georoc/) compilation of 8,531 analyses of SiO2, Rb and Sr concentrations, in crustal rocks sampled in central and southwestern America, at sites of various crustal thickness. These data were used in Dhuime et al. (2015, Nature Geoscience 8, 552-555) to establish a positive correlation between Rb/Sr (or SiO2) and crustal thickness in sites of generation of new continental crust. The crustal thickness is calculated from the latitude and longitude coordinates of the samples and the Crust 1.0 model (http://igppweb.ucsd.edu/~gabi/crust1.html), as summarised in Dhuime et al. 2015 (Nature Geoscience 8, 552-555).
